Red Bull to visit Pamplona for Bull running

Red Bull to visit Pamplona for Bull running

11 June 2008

Red Bull Racing driver David Coulthard and Scuderia Toro Rosso driver Sebastien Bourdais will visit the famous 'bull running' event in Pamplona, Spain, at the end of this month. The event is famous for the many tourists that attend the event where they run through the Pamplona streets with bulls chasing them.

On the 28th of June around 500 men will start the 'race' through the streets of Pamplona at 08.00am. But instead of having bulls chasing the men down there will be two Formula 1 drivers, Coulthard and Bourdais, that will chase the running madmen at the 0.800km track.

In the afternoon, at 17.00, there will be a 2km roadtrack for a special Formula 1 demonstration.
